excel两个数怎么转换为三个数

excel两个数怎么转换为三个数

在Excel中,将两个数转换为三个数有几种方法:拆分、计算平均值、插值法。其中,插值法是最常用的方法之一,它可以根据两点之间的距离,通过插值来生成中间的数值。下面将详细介绍插值法及其他方法。

一、拆分

拆分方法是将两个数直接拆分成三个数。假设有两个数 AB,可以简单地将它们拆分成三个数,如 A(A+B)/2B。这种方法适用于需要简单分割的场景。

  1. 直接拆分:这是最简单的方法。假设有两个数 A = 10B = 20,我们可以直接在中间插入一个数,使得三者间有一定的逻辑关系。插入的数可以是 (A + B) / 2 = 15。即,最终得到的三个数为 10、15 和 20。

  2. 按比例拆分:如果有特定的比例关系,可以按照比例将两个数拆分为三个。例如,假设我们希望在 1020 之间找到一个数,使得比例关系为 1:2,则可以计算出 10 + (20-10)/3 = 13.3310 + 2*(20-10)/3 = 16.67。这样得到的三个数为 1013.3316.67

二、计算平均值

计算平均值的方法是通过对两个数的平均值进行计算,然后将结果插入到两个数之间。这种方法适用于需要平滑过渡的场景。

  1. 简单平均值:假设有两个数 AB,可以通过计算它们的平均值来插入一个中间数。公式为 (A + B) / 2。例如,有两个数 1020,其平均值为 (10 + 20) / 2 = 15。最终得到的三个数为 101520

  2. 加权平均值:如果需要考虑加权因素,可以使用加权平均值的方法。例如,假设有两个数 AB,权重分别为 w1w2,则加权平均值的公式为 (A * w1 + B * w2) / (w1 + w2)。这样可以根据具体需求插入不同的中间数。

三、插值法

插值法是通过在两个数之间插入合适的中间数,使得生成的数值具有一定的规律性。常见的插值方法包括线性插值和非线性插值。

  1. 线性插值:线性插值是最简单的一种插值方法。假设有两个数 AB,通过线性插值可以在它们之间插入一个或多个中间数。公式为 A + (B - A) * t,其中 t 是插值因子,取值范围为 [0, 1]。例如,有两个数 1020,插值因子 t0.330.67,则中间数分别为 10 + (20 - 10) * 0.33 = 13.310 + (20 - 10) * 0.67 = 16.7。最终得到的三个数为 1013.316.7

  2. 非线性插值:非线性插值包括多项式插值、样条插值等方法。假设有两个数 AB,可以通过多项式插值在它们之间插入一个或多个中间数。多项式插值的公式较为复杂,需要根据具体情况进行计算。样条插值是一种常见的非线性插值方法,它通过构建样条函数在两个数之间插入中间数,使得生成的数值具有更高的平滑性和准确性。

  3. Excel中的插值函数:在Excel中,可以使用插值函数来实现插值操作。常见的插值函数包括 FORECAST.LINEARFORECAST.ETSFORECAST.LINEAR 函数用于线性插值,FORECAST.ETS 函数用于指数平滑插值。通过这些插值函数,可以方便地在Excel中实现插值操作,生成所需的中间数。

四、插值法的实际应用

下面详细介绍如何在Excel中使用插值法将两个数转换为三个数。

1. 准备数据

假设有两个数 A = 10B = 20,需要在它们之间插入一个中间数。

2. 使用线性插值

在Excel中,可以使用以下公式进行线性插值:

= A + (B - A) * t

其中,t 是插值因子,取值范围为 [0, 1]。例如,插值因子 t0.5,则插值公式为:

= 10 + (20 - 10) * 0.5

计算结果为 15。最终得到的三个数为 101520

3. 使用 FORECAST.LINEAR 函数

在Excel中,可以使用 FORECAST.LINEAR 函数进行线性插值。假设有两个数 AB,插值因子 t0.330.67,可以使用以下公式进行计算:

= FORECAST.LINEAR(0.33, {A, B}, {0, 1})

= FORECAST.LINEAR(0.67, {A, B}, {0, 1})

计算结果分别为 13.316.7。最终得到的三个数为 1013.316.7

4. 使用样条插值

样条插值是一种常见的非线性插值方法。在Excel中,可以使用第三方插件或自定义函数进行样条插值。假设有两个数 AB,可以通过样条插值在它们之间插入一个或多个中间数。样条插值的公式较为复杂,需要根据具体情况进行计算。

5. 实际应用案例

假设有一组数据,需要在两个数之间插入一个中间数,使得生成的数值具有一定的规律性。可以使用线性插值或样条插值方法进行处理。

例如,有一组数据 1020,需要在它们之间插入一个中间数。可以使用线性插值方法,通过计算插值因子 t 的值,生成中间数。最终得到的三个数为 101520

五、总结

在Excel中,将两个数转换为三个数的方法有多种,包括拆分、计算平均值和插值法。插值法是最常用的方法之一,通过插值可以生成中间数,使得生成的数值具有一定的规律性。插值方法包括线性插值和非线性插值,具体选择哪种方法需要根据具体情况而定。

通过合理使用Excel中的插值函数,如 FORECAST.LINEARFORECAST.ETS,可以方便地实现插值操作,生成所需的中间数。在实际应用中,可以根据具体需求选择合适的插值方法,确保生成的数值具有较高的准确性和平滑性。

相关问答FAQs:

1. 为什么需要将两个数转换为三个数?

  • 在某些情况下,我们可能需要将两个数进行转换,以便获得更多的信息或满足特定的需求。将两个数转换为三个数可以帮助我们更好地分析数据或进行进一步的计算。

2. 如何将两个数转换为三个数?

  • 一种常见的方法是使用加法或减法。我们可以将两个数相加或相减,然后将结果与另一个数进行比较或计算。例如,如果我们有两个数a和b,我们可以将它们相加得到c,然后将c与另一个数d相比较,得到一个新的数e。

3. 什么是数值转换的应用场景?

  • 数值转换可以应用于许多领域,例如金融、统计学和工程。在金融领域,将两个数转换为三个数可以帮助我们计算投资回报率或利润率。在统计学中,数值转换可以帮助我们分析数据的趋势或比较不同组之间的差异。在工程领域,数值转换可以用于计算机模拟或优化问题的解决方案。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4753167

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部